How To Fix FDT_WD_SERVICE000 - Unknown business object &1 in namespace &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FDT_WD_SERVICE - FDT_WD: Message class for messages in SFDT_WD_SERVICE

  • Message number: 000

  • Message text: Unknown business object &1 in namespace &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message FDT_WD_SERVICE000 - Unknown business object &1 in namespace &2 ?

    The SAP error message FDT_WD_SERVICE000 Unknown business object &1 in namespace &2 typically occurs in the context of SAP's Flexible Data Import (FDI) or when working with the Web Dynpro framework. This error indicates that the system is unable to recognize or find the specified business object in the given namespace.

    Cause:

    1. Incorrect Business Object Name: The business object specified in the error message does not exist or is misspelled.
    2. Namespace Issues: The namespace provided may not be correctly defined or may not contain the specified business object.
    3.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ues in the system that prevent the business object from being recognized.
    4. Transport Issues: If the business object was recently transported from another system, it may not have been properly imported or activated in the target system.
    5.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the specified business object.

    Solution:

    1. Verify Business Object Name: Check the spelling and ensure that the business object name is correct. You can do this by looking it up in the relevant transaction or configuration area.
    2. Check Namespace: Ensure that the namespace is correctly defined and that the business object exists within that namespace. You can use transaction codes like SE80 or SE11 to explore the objects.
    3.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ings related to the business object. Ensure that all necessary settings are in place and that the object is properly configured.
    4. Transport Check: If the business object was recently transported, verify that the transport was successful and that all necessary objects were included. You may need to re-import or activate the transport.
    5. Authorization Check: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the business object. You can check this in transaction SU53 or by reviewing the user's roles and authorizations.
    6.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ific business object or the error message for additional troubleshooting steps.
